Joint custody is a common arrangement in which both parents share the responsibilities of raising their children after a divorce or separation. This type of custody can involve shared decision-making about the children’s upbringing and well-being. In the following examples of sentences featuring joint custody, you will see how this arrangement can be expressed in various contexts.

When parents opt for joint custody, they typically agree to work together to make important decisions regarding their children’s education, healthcare, and upbringing. This arrangement aims to ensure that both parents have an active role in their children’s lives, fostering a sense of stability and continuity for the kids. Tips for Using Joint Custody in Sentences Properly

When talking about joint custody, it’s essential to remember a few key tips to ensure you’re using it correctly in your sentences. Here are some guidelines to keep in mind:

  1. Be Clear and Specific: When referring to joint custody, make sure you specify whether it’s joint physical custody (where the child spends significant time with both parents) or joint legal custody (where both parents share decision-making authority).

  2. Use the Term Correctly: Avoid mixing up joint custody with other types of custody arrangements, such as sole custody or split custody. Each has distinct meanings and implications, so using the right term is crucial.

  3. Consider the Context: Think about the context in which you’re discussing joint custody. Are you explaining a legal concept, sharing a personal experience, or analyzing a case study? Tailor your language accordingly to ensure clarity.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Now, let’s address some common mistakes that people make when talking about joint custody. By avoiding these pitfalls, you can elevate your communication skills and better convey your message:

  1. Confusing Joint Custody with Equal Time: Joint custody does not automatically mean that the child spends an equal amount of time with each parent. It refers to the sharing of responsibilities and decision-making, not necessarily time allocation.
